Softball Recap: South Greene Rebels vs. Chuckey-Doak Black Knights

In what's become a running theme this season, South Greene gave their fans yet another huge victory on Monday. They put the hurt on the Chuckey-Doak Black Knights with a sharp 12-4 win. Winning may never get old, but South Greene sure is getting used to it with their third in a row.

Kaylee Whitson sp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ered three earned (and one unearned) runs on 13 hits. She has been consistent recently: she hasn't pitched less than six innings in three consecutive pitching appearances.

On the hitting side, Haven Carter was incredible,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 3-for-4. Whitney Reaves was another key contributor,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 3-for-4.

South Greene's victory bumped their record up to 12-6. As for Chuckey-Doak,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 2-13.

South Greene will head out on the road to square off against West Greene at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Chuckey-Doak, they will look to defend their home field on Tuesday against Hampton at 5:00 p.m.
